Expert Q&A: How big should my insurance policy be?

Question:

How big should my insurance policy be?

Answer:

To bill the insurance companies for windshield repair, you must obtain a $500,000 general liability insurance policy. Often, general liability policies do not cover damage to the vehicle. So, we recommend discussing garage keeper’s coverage with your insurance agent. Determine if this add-on policy is right for you. Typically, it may be possible to use a garage keeper’s policy if damage occurred to the vehicle, whether by you or some other means, when it is in your care, custody, and control.


Expert Q&A: Where can I find the best rate on $500,000 to $1,000,000 of liability insurance?

Question:

Where can I find the best rate on $500,000 to $1,000,000 of liability insurance to start my windshield repair business?

Answer:

You should be able to contact any insurance company to request a quote, or you can google “where to get 500K worth of general liability insurance” and many reputable companies pop up.

While we do not recommend or endorse any insurance companies, many of our customers have found that RLI offers very competitive rates. Chris Alexander (information below) writes a lot of RLI policies for windshield repair professionals in all 50 states, so he is a good place to start, then call a local independent insurance agent and have them see if they can find you a better deal.
